Create
Make a Meme
Make a GIF
Make a Chart
Make a Demotivational
When you can sign into the Epic Store with your Steam account
share
605 views
•
4 upvotes
•
Made by
MindsEyeTHPS
3 years ago
in
gaming
steam
valve
epic
epic games
epic store
ironic
Add Meme
Add Image
Post Comment
Show More Comments
Created with the Imgflip
Meme Generator